Ulster’s Afoa banned for Euro semi

The ERC have admitted John Afoa’s tackle on Felix Jones deserved a red card.

The announcement came after yesterday’s decision to ban the New Zealand prop for four weeks which means he will miss the Heineken Cup semi-final clash with Edinburgh.

Afoa had taken pride in his disciplinary record throughout his professional career; he had never received a single yellow or red card but fell foul of the citing commissioner following last week’s defeat of Munster at Thomond Park.
